Overview

The PURE'AM Amino Acid Mild Face Cleanser 120ml is a Korean-formulated daily cleanser built around one core idea: clean your skin without punishing it. Its defining quality is a micro-foaming texture powered by amino acid surfactants — a gentler alternative to the sulfate-based cleansers that leave your face feeling tight and stripped. The formula skips artificial fragrance, parabens, silicone, and sulfates entirely, which makes the ingredient list refreshingly clean for a K-beauty product at this price range. That said, this is a gentle daily cleanser, not a corrective treatment. If you're expecting dramatic acne-clearing results overnight, you'll want to recalibrate those expectations before hitting add to cart.

Features & Benefits

What makes this Korean amino acid cleanser interesting isn't just what it leaves out — it's what it actually puts in. The salicylic acid, while mild in concentration, works quietly to keep pores from congesting over time; don't expect dramatic results in a week, but consistent use does make a difference. The formula also leans on a blend of prebiotics and postbiotics through its Dandelion Postbiome Technology, designed to support the skin's microbiome rather than disrupt it. On top of that, botanicals like mugwort, Houttuynia Cordata, and Tea Tree help calm reactive or red-prone skin. After rinsing, your skin genuinely doesn't feel dry — that's the amino acid difference showing up.

FAQ

This Korean amino acid cleanser is specifically formulated for daily use — morning and evening included. Because it relies on amino acid surfactants rather than harsh sulfates, it won't degrade your skin barrier with repeated washing the way more aggressive cleansers can. Most users with sensitive or dry skin find it comfortable to use twice a day without irritation.

It can contribute to clearer skin over time, but be realistic about what a rinse-off cleanser can do. The salicylic acid here is at a mild concentration, and because it's washed off, it has limited contact time with your skin. Think of it as a maintenance ingredient that helps keep pores from congesting — not a spot treatment or a replacement for a dedicated BHA serum if you're dealing with persistent acne.

It works well for oily skin as a daily wash, though the approach is balancing rather than stripping. Rather than aggressively removing all oil — which often triggers more oil production — this gentle foaming wash helps maintain a clean, pH-balanced surface. Many oily-skin users find that switching from harsh cleansers to a gentler amino acid formula actually helps regulate oiliness over time, not worsen it.

Yes, and it's actually a natural fit as the second step in a double cleanse. After using an oil-based cleanser or cleansing balm to break down SPF and makeup, this acts as the water-based follow-up that removes any remaining residue and finishes with a balanced, clean surface. It's gentle enough that using it as a second step won't over-cleanse your skin.
